Output d908123bc592724fadce60ee0cc95d06d984bb02b20392c07b4bf18e7ba43357:0

value
84925000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f09c4fb365f7052dbb005648b7564c7b71f8cc9 OP_EQUALVERIFY OP_CHECKSIG
address
1E3KLE5wMiHgGkuZ71Mbgg8hx3ttAiHbt9
transaction
d908123bc592724fadce60ee0cc95d06d984bb02b20392c07b4bf18e7ba43357
spent
true